VPS(Virtual Private Server,虚拟专用服务器)服务器管理助手是一种工具或服务,旨在帮助用户更方便、高效地管理和维护他们的VPS服务器。这类工具通常提供一系列功能,如远程访问、系统监控、备份恢复、安全管理、性能优化等。
VPS服务器管理助手通过图形用户界面(GUI)或命令行接口(CLI)提供对VPS服务器的控制和管理。它允许用户在不直接接触服务器硬件的情况下,执行各种管理任务。
VPS服务器管理助手可以分为以下几类:
VPS服务器管理助手适用于各种需要远程管理和维护VPS服务器的场景,包括但不限于:
以下是一个使用Python编写的简单VPS服务器管理脚本示例,用于远程执行命令:
import paramiko
def execute_command(hostname, username, password, command):
client = paramiko.SSHClient()
client.set_missing_host_key_policy(paramiko.AutoAddPolicy())
client.connect(hostname, username=username, password=password)
stdin, stdout, stderr = client.exec_command(command)
output = stdout.read().decode('utf-8')
error = stderr.read().decode('utf-8')
client.close()
return output, error
# 示例用法
hostname = 'your_vps_hostname'
username = 'your_username'
password = 'your_password'
command = 'ls -l'
output, error = execute_command(hostname, username, password, command)
print('Output:', output)
print('Error:', error)
请注意,以上示例代码仅供参考,实际使用时需要根据具体情况进行调整和完善。同时,确保在远程执行命令时采取适当的安全措施,以防止潜在的安全风险。
领取专属 10元无门槛券
手把手带您无忧上云